Manufacturing And Energy Supply Chain Demonstrations And Commercial Applications federal funding in FY2024

CFDA 81.253 in fiscal year 2024 is coded at $1,882,786,287 on USAspending.gov for Manufacturing And Energy Supply Chain Demonstrations And Commercial Applications. Program extract-wide, the same catalog line shows $3,141,691,257 across 70 awards. That yearlyTrend cell is 59.9% of this program’s published obligation total of $3,141,691,257. FY2024 as the manufacturing and energy supply-chain yearlyTrend cell

An obligation is a legal commitment recorded on an award. An outlay is a payment from the Treasury. $1,882,786,287 is the former for Manufacturing & Energy Supply Chain in FY2024. Later deobligations, recoveries, or payment schedules can change what leaves the Treasury without this join rewriting itself into a cash register. This page reports $1,882,786,287 as given.
